WTA's Controversial Choice

  • 🎾 The WTA officially named the Coco Gauff vs. Zheng Qinwen semi-final match in Rome as its Match of the Year for 2025.
  • ⚠️ This decision sparked significant controversy among tennis fans and purists due to the match's perceived low quality.
  • πŸ“Š Critics highlighted the match's statistics, including 156 unforced errors and 20 double faults, calling it "ugly" tennis.

The Marathon Match Details

  • ⏱️ The match was an absolute marathon, lasting 3 hours and 34 minutes, with Gauff ultimately winning 7-6, 4-6, 7-6.
  • πŸš€ Coco Gauff staged an absurd comeback, clawing back from being 3-5 down in the deciding third set to force and win a tie-break.
  • πŸ’¬ Gauff herself admitted the court conditions were slow and the ball heavy, stating the tennis wasn't her best level.

Critics vs. WTA's Rationale

  • 🧐 Tennis purists were horrified, arguing that the award should celebrate technical excellence and pristine shot-making, not errors.
  • 🎯 The WTA's logic focused on drama, stakes, emotional investment, and the sheer fight displayed by both players throughout the unpredictable battle.
  • ✨ The match involved marketable stars like Gauff and Zheng Qinwen, providing compelling storylines and promotional value for the sport.

Broader Implications

  • πŸ“ˆ The WTA's decision signals a strategy to appeal to a broader, casual audience who value entertainment and tension over technical perfection.
  • πŸ€ This approach is compared to other sports like basketball or football, where dramatic, messy games with multiple comebacks are celebrated as classics.
  • 🎾 The match also represents the modern, physical style of women's tennis, characterized by power, attrition, and intense baseline battles, even if not always aesthetically pleasing.
